The Ultimate Island Honeymoon Showdown
Maldives and Mauritius are two of the most popular honeymoon destinations for Indian couples. Both offer pristine beaches, turquoise waters, and romantic settings — but they deliver very different experiences. Let's break down the comparison to help you choose.
Beaches & Water
Maldives: 9/10 — The Maldives has some of the clearest water on Earth. The atolls create natural lagoons with visibility up to 40 meters. Overwater villas let you literally live on the ocean. However, each resort is on a private island, so beach variety is limited to your resort.
Mauritius: 8/10 — Mauritius offers more diverse beaches — from the calm Le Morne in the south to the lively Grand Baie in the north. The underwater waterfall illusion (viewed from helicopter) is a unique natural wonder you won't find in Maldives.
Budget Comparison
Maldives: ₹1,50,000-3,00,000 per couple for 5 nights. Maldives is a premium destination — even mid-range resorts are expensive, and everything on the island (food, drinks, activities) carries a resort markup.
Mauritius: ₹1,00,000-2,00,000 per couple for 6 nights. Mauritius offers significantly better value. You can eat at local restaurants outside your hotel, rent a car affordably, and explore the island independently.
Winner: Mauritius for budget-conscious couples.
Activities & Experiences
Maldives: Snorkeling with manta rays, underwater restaurant dining, dolphin cruises, private sandbank picnics, bioluminescent beach walks, sunset fishing. It's mostly water-based activities.
Mauritius: Everything Maldives offers PLUS zip-lining, quad biking, hiking Le Morne mountain, rum distillery tours, Chamarel coloured earth, Casela safari park, and exploring Port Louis markets. Much more diverse.
Winner: Mauritius for activity variety; Maldives for pure water experiences.
Romance Factor
Maldives: 10/10 — Nothing beats the sheer romance of a private overwater villa with a glass floor, outdoor shower, and direct ocean access. The isolation creates an intimate bubble for couples.
Mauritius: 8/10 — Beautiful and romantic, but it's a larger island with towns and traffic. Resorts are gorgeous but you don't get the same level of private island exclusivity as Maldives.
Winner: Maldives for pure romance.
Food
Maldives: Resort food is international and high-quality but expensive. Limited options — you eat where you stay. Indian food is usually available at most resorts.
Mauritius: Incredible Creole-French-Indian fusion cuisine. Street food is amazing and affordable. The variety of restaurants outside resorts gives you much more culinary freedom. Dholl puri (Mauritian flatbread) is a must-try.
Winner: Mauritius for food variety and value.
Our Verdict
Choose Maldives if: You want pure luxury, overwater villa experience, maximum romance, and budget isn't the primary concern.
Choose Mauritius if: You want diverse experiences, better value for money, varied cuisine, and activities beyond the beach.
